BSc (Hons) Management Accounting
is a 18-month degree designed for students who want to develop skills in financial management and analysis.This course is ideal for those who wish to pursue a career in management accounting, focusing on the application of financial knowledge to support business decision-making.
Some key areas of study include: financial reporting, budgeting, forecasting, and performance analysis.
Through a combination of lectures, seminars, and practical exercises, students will gain a deep understanding of management accounting principles and practices.
Graduates of this course will be equipped with the skills and knowledge required to succeed in management accounting roles, such as financial planning, analysis, and control.
